Chiefs vs. Chargers Predictions, Betting Trends and Stats – Week 7

Written By PlayPicks Staff on October 17, 2023 - Last Updated on September 25, 2024

The 4:25 PM ET game on October 22 between the Los Angeles Chargers (2-3) and the Kansas City Chiefs (5-1) should be a competitive matchup, as Keenan Allen has been one of the league’s top pass-catchers this season, and the Chiefs have been a top-five pass defense, ranking fifth-best in the NFL with 183.8 passing yards allowed per contest.

The Chiefs are 5.5-point favorites against the Chargers. The total is set at 47.5 points.

Chiefs Betting Insights

  • The Chiefs have four wins in six games against the spread this year.
  • Kansas City has two wins ATS (2-1) as a 5.5-point or higher favorite in 2023.
  • Two of the Chiefs’ six games have gone over the point total.
  • The total for this game is 47.5, 1.3 points fewer than the average total in Kansas City games thus far this season.

Chargers Betting Insights

  • The Chargers have one win against the spread this year.
  • The Chargers have played two games (out of five) which finished over the total this year.
  • Los Angeles games have gone over 47.5 points on three occasions this season.
  • The average total points scored in Chargers games this year (47.5) is 2.0 points higher than the total for this matchup.

Chiefs Players to Watch

  • Patrick Mahomes II leads Kansas City with 1,593 yards (265.5 ypg) on 153-of-224 passing with 11 touchdowns and five interceptions this season. He also has 185 rushing yards on 29 carries.
  • Isiah Pacheco has carried the ball 87 times for a team-high 387 yards on the ground and has found the end zone three times as a runner. He’s also tacked on 17 catches for 135 yards (22.5 per game).
  • Travis Kelce’s team-leading 346 yards as a receiver have come on 36 catches (out of 46 targets) with three touchdowns.
  • Rashee Rice has caught 21 passes for 245 yards (40.8 yards per game) and two touchdowns this year.
  • Noah Gray’s 12 catches have turned into 147 yards and one touchdown.
  • Chris Jones has 5.5 sacks to pace the team, and also has 4.0 TFL and 12 tackles.
  • Drue Tranquill is the team’s leading tackler this year. He’s picked up 34 tackles, 1.0 TFL, and 1.5 sacks.
  • Mike Edwards leads the team with one interception, while also collecting 12 tackles, 2.0 TFL, 1.0 sack, and four passes defended.

Chargers Players to Watch

  • Justin Herbert has 1,332 passing yards, or 266.4 per game, this season. He has completed 68.7% of his passes and has thrown nine touchdowns with two interceptions. He’s also helped out on the ground with 15.2 rushing yards per game while scoring as a runner three times.
  • Joshua Kelley is his team’s leading rusher with 58 carries for 209 yards, or 41.8 per game. He’s found the end zone one time on the ground, as well.
  • Austin Ekeler has racked up 144 yards (on 30 attempts) with one touchdown, while also catching eight passes for 82 yards.
  • Allen leads his squad with 519 receiving yards on 42 catches with four touchdowns.
  • Josh Palmer has collected 220 receiving yards (44.0 yards per game) and one touchdown on 15 receptions.
  • Gerald Everett’s 19 targets have resulted in 16 catches for 123 yards and one touchdown.
  • Khalil Mack leads the team with 7.0 sacks, and also has 6.0 TFL and 23 tackles.
  • Kenneth Murray, Los Angeles’ leading tackler, has 35 tackles, 4.0 TFL, 1.0 sack, and one interception this year.
  • Asante Samuel Jr. has a team-high one interception to go along with 26 tackles, 1.0 TFL, and three passes defended.
